Georgia Tech vs Miami UNDER 54.5:

This number appears pretty high for two teams that run the ball more often then they go through the air. GT has switched to the option offense and their QB has looked very poor so far this year throwing the ball. Miami’s D will likely put 8 to 9 in the box to help shut down the run and force GT’s QB to beat them through the air. Miami is also at their best on the ground, if last week verse Florida State was indicator of things left to come this year. I also think with this being an important tough conference game the defenses will both be on lock down tonight. Look for this score to be much lower than either of these teams previous contests. I see the score being more like 30-14, Miami. Even though I like Miami, I am not playing them because of that very tough, physical battle they had with Florida State last out, there still may be some lingering effect.

The Play UNDER 54.5   1 unit

OAKLAND RAIDERS +3 @ KANSAS CITY CHIEFS

Oh, so the Raiders don’t suck so bad after all.  They had a decent defense in decent offense.  They may even rank 16th in both categories this season.  The Chiefs put up 24 points on the Ravens, what?  7 of those came via a blocked punt in the end zone, so that really doesn’t count.  I think this game should be low scoring and back and forth with a few lead changes.  Odds are it comes down to a field goal, so I think you’re better suited taking the Raiders with the +3.  Under 38.5 looks interesting, but stands to be close to that number.

Prediction: Raiders 20 – Chiefs 17

Free Picks: Raiders +3 (Confidence: 2/5), Under 38.5 (Confidence: 2/5)

The line on the Bears/Packers game has moved to Bears +5.  I don’t love either team with the spread in this one.  The Packers could either run it up if Rodgers comes out with his A game, but the Bears also have one of the best defenses in the league and could cause Rodgers to struggle and force some punts.

On the other hand, I’m not expecting much from the Bears on the road.  Maybe 17-20 points max and possibly 13-16 points.  I put the Packers at about 20-24 points, maybe 27 max.  Odds are this game is something in the ballpark of Packers 24-17.  Maybe Packers 20-17.  I think it’s going to be a tight game due to two solid defenses.  I see a slow start from teams that will feel each other out.  Odds are this game starts slow, the only question is if Cutler and Rodgers end hot.

I still think the defenses dominate this game, so the spread on this game is a toss up.  I really like the under 46.5 and I also think the Packers win by about a TD.  I see around 40 points being scored in this game.  I would be surprised if this ends in 47 points.  A 27-20 game seems a little out of reach.  As things stand right now, under 46.5 is my play on this game tonight.

Prediction: Packers 24 – Bears 17

Free Pick: Under 46.5 (Confidence: 3/5), Packers -5 (Confidence: 2/5)…

It was already crazy week in college football.  I capitalized on Brandon’s picks of Wake Forest and Auburn, but took what I would consider a bad beat on the Michigan game, and ended up short with USC.  ND should have not only won that game, but should have covered, and did cover with 2 minutes left.  Bad penalties, giving up a kickoff return, and a missed FG cost them that one.  In the OSU game, the OSU front 7 stepped up for them and shut down USC’s run.  OSU’s front 7 was their Achilles heel in the Navy game.  USC didn’t really use Joe McKnight until the 2nd half either.  USC also was struggling with starting field position the entire game since they had to start several drives within their own 10 yard line.  That forced them into a lot of punting situations.  If they got to start more drives between the 20-40, I have a feeling they would have put a lot more points on the board.
